The commission may, with the approval of the board of supervisors, appoint and fix the compensation of a clerk, and his necessary office assistants, and it may also employ and appoint an engineer or engineers and other experts, and, if in its judgment it is necessary, employ an attorney. All employees and appointees shall hold office at the pleasure of the commission.
Cal. Harb. & Nav. Code § 4047
Harbor Commission
Enacted by Stats. 1937, Ch. 368.
